A silent disease We are facing a disease that may go unnoticed because their symptoms are not recognized until they have an associated condition.
Hypertension occurs when elevated blood pressure levels on a continuous or sustained, which causes the heart muscle increases to meet this extra effort and ends up being harmful because it is not accompanied by a corresponding increase in blood flow . A high percentage of patients do not even know they are hypertensive by what they can not avoid its consequences for health, “says Dr. María Victoria Cañadas Godoy, a cardiologist at USP San Camilo. Data are increasing hypertension, which affects Spanish 10 million according to the INE, the cardiovascular risk factor prevalence and incidence figures are very high: 15% of world population and 40% of the Spanish population (47% of men and 39% of women) have it. The high figure for Spain, as well as other countries with the same level of development is explained by an aging population, longer survival with cardiovascular disease and increased risk factors such as obesity.
By age, the most sufferers are over 65 years as the prevalence was 60%. Given these figures, Dr. Pilar Mazon, president of the Arterial Hypertension Section of the Spanish Society of Cardiology, says that “at any age is important to control blood pressure. Forget the false rumor that there was a few years ago that was not serious about the blood pressure increase with age. The blood pressure should be maintained within normal ranges for all ages to reduce the risk of cardiovascular complications. ” What about the young? The data indicate that in young children and the prevalence of hypertension is increasingly on the rise , is 30% of young people and between 3% and 7% of children who suffer the disease. “It is worrying that children and young people have the disease because it makes them more likely to suffer a cardiac event as a myocardial infarction, stroke or arrhythmia. This increase in prevalence rates is due to both poor nutrition, resulting in an overweight, as a familial predisposition for the disease, because if either of the two parents has hypertension possibilities that the child also develops disease is 45%, according to various studies, “concluded the doctor. The amounts considered normal systolic blood pressure (maximum) are between 120-129 mmHg and diastolic (minimum) between 80 and 84 mmHg. Prevention, your best friend The best treatment for hypertension is a good prevention to avoid their appearance. Key to this is to follow a heart-healthy lifestyle: not smoke. The snuff raises blood pressure and heart rate. In addition, hypertensive smokers multiply the detrimental effect of snuff. One thing for thought: stop smoking has positive effects outweigh any medication for hypertension. Beware of the alcohol. Moderate consumption of alcohol (one glass of wine a day with meals) may be beneficial, but if it causes excessive increase in blood pressure and other conditions prejudicial heart and other organs.
Control your weight. Overweight is a cause of hypertension. Therefore, lowering blood pressure decreases and reduces the risk of cardiovascular and diabetes. In form. The regular physical exercise gets lower blood pressure. It increases muscle mass and exercise capacity, helps control weight and reduce cardiovascular risk achieved. Practice heart-healthy diet. Hypertensive patients should reduce salt intake and foods containing it. Also need to eat fruits, vegetables, legumes, nuts, bread and other cereals. Finally, use olive oil as main fat and increasing intake of poultry and fish at the expense of red meat. Pharmacotherapy. If you can not settle for hypertension with the above recommendations, as you may need to continue drug treatment. The results do not always reflect an immediate reduction in blood pressure, so you need to wait a bit before considering a change to the doctor for medication.
Hibiscus Tea to lower blood pressure
The hibiscus tea is used quite frequently in folk medicine, especially for control of the flu. However, applications of the hibiscus plant ( Hibiscus sabdariffa ) are multiple, and one of them has been demonstrated by researchers at Tufts University.
Publishing in The Journal of Nutrition, the researchers conducted a study in which we have studied the properties of hibiscus on the cardiovascular health, demonstrating that the infusion of hibiscus can be helpful for people with hypertension.
In one experimental study with patients, researchers found that hibiscus reduces blood pressure compared with placebo in significant percentages.
In concrete terms, the tea daily hibiscus tea served to reduce systolic blood pressure and diastolic pressure by about six times more than in the placebo group.
The researchers recommend that infusions of Hibiscus tea are made three times a day to produce effects, although to a lesser degree can also help.
Prevent hypertension
Today one of the diseases most common we hear is the hypertension. This is a problem in people of all ages, but it grows as we age. Prevention of hypertension is difficult, but with good will and good habits can help ensure a good health in this regard.
Hypertension involves high blood pressure , which may lead not only in circulatory problems, but also kidney problems and even heart attacks, which can be fatal.
The worst combination is overweight with hypertension. To prevent hypertension is necessary first of all look so overweight. The obesity is the best scenario for developing the disease, and it is therefore important to follow a healthy diet that allows you to have a normal weight.
By the way, speaking of diet, the other main measure to prevent the onset of the disease is to avoid sodium in foods. Cut the salt you consume, but as a whole, at least in large part. The high salt intake may increase the risk of the disease.
Age is another major cause of hypertension , and if you are over forty years and are at risk of developing it. If your family history, be careful because it is a hereditary disease.
If all this still did not manage to clear the blood pressure, talk with your doctor to prescribe drugs. This is not ideal, but if it helps improve health.

Foods that help against hypertension
A few weeks ago we began to implement, as you know, a special guide on high, through which, from the outset, we have known that hypertension can be a serious problem, which is the high blood pressure, and some habits that can increase our blood pressure.
We know, for example, that hypertension is a condition in which there are blood pressure above 140/90 mmHg., (As defined carried out by the Spanish Society of Hypertension-Spanish League for the Fight Against Hypertension Blood , SEH-LELHA) and blood pressure is the force that blood exerts on the artery walls.
But there are some foods that will help us greatly to control hypertension? Are there, therefore, foods that help us control our blood pressure?
Here we collect some of the most important foods, on which, for the past few decades have shown that they are good against high blood pressure :
Tomato
It has an ingredient called lycopene, which is the main tomato, which has a powerful antioxidant, helping to maintain the health of the arteries and thus preserving their flexibility to expand and contract the blood flow.
Bananas
They have a large amount of potassium, which has proved essential for the proper body fluid balance, an issue which among other things ensures adequate blood pressure.
Melon
Like bananas, contains a large amount of potassium, and especially water (approximately 80%), so it becomes a really good food that provides liquid, such as watermelon , helping to eliminate toxins, thus promoting the flow blood.
Black chocolate
It contains a powerful antioxidant due to its polyphenolic flavonoids , which when consumed produces a significant drop in blood pressure, resulting in a better blood flow.
Dates
Like the melon and bananas, contain potassium, which focuses mainly after the drying of this fruit, also reducing its water content.

Food for Hypertension
High blood pressure, hypertension can be controlled better if you have a feed with those ingredients that may come in handy for this problem.
Broadly, three main groups are the ones who will benefit: foods rich in potassium, calcium and vitamin C, plus some “special” properties that are great for these issues. Here’s a list of “inevitable” in your daily diet:
Foods rich in vitamin C: These are great for hypertension, because the vitamin acts as relaxing those arteries that are severely stressed. This is how it will benefit you eat citrus fruits (lemons, strawberries, oranges, etc.), peppers or carrots.
Foods rich in potassium: This mineral is usually good to counteract the effects of sodium, something like his opponent. For this reason, incorporating foods rich in potassium can cum really well. Among them should tell the potatoes, courgettes, peaches, peas and bananas.
Calcium-rich foods: This also is a mineral that you may find it excellent for hypertension. But not necessarily have to incorporate it with milk. You can use foods like almonds, tofu, broccoli and legumes. All foods rich in calcium and easy to incorporate into your diet.
The Garlic : This is one of those special foods to combat hypertension. Of great influence on the bloodstream, it can even prepare a soup for hypertension .
